Overview Of Medicare Supplement Plans
There are 10 standardized Medigap insurance plans. These plans are controlled by the US authorities Medicare and are made to work with First Medicare to pay for what Original Medicare doesn’t cover in full (the 20% that is left over). Medicare supplement plans are identified by a insurance plan letter A-N. Because the insurance plans controlled and are standardized, the gains are the same no matter what business is offering the Medigap insurance. The only difference between exactly the same plan letter with distinct companies is the price. For example, a Plan F with Aetna and a Plan F with AARP are the same the only difference between them is the price that the carriers charge.. .. Medigap Insurance Plan F
Medicare Supplement Plan F is among the very popular accessory insurance plans. This Medigap plan covers 100% of all that is left over by Original Medicare. By way of example, F insures all hospital bills, the Part A deductible, and whatever happens in a doctor ‘s office or every other medical facility at 100%. This can be the only plan that offers full all-inclusive coverage to 100%.
Medigap Plan G
Medicare Supplement Plan G is a insurance plan we like to recommend the most and frequently known as the Gold Plan. It is virtually identical to Plan F. The only difference is an annual deductible of $166 for the year on Plan G. Other than that the benefits are exactly the same as Plan F. When Is The Best Time To Buy A Medicare Supplement Plan?
The best time to purchase Medicare Supplement Plan is when you are first eligible for Medicare; for Medigap during your open enrollment. During this time which starts six months before your 65th birthday and continue for half a year after your 65th birthday you are able to sign up for a Medicare Supplement Plan regardless of your health. There are no questions for pre existing states and you are able to get any Medigap plan you desire from any carrier
If you are past the age of 65 and looking to change plans or get an idea for the first time you may need to answer some fundamental health questions to qualify. Most folks and qualify so you still ought to have the ability to get a plan.
